noun, noun or participle which takes 'suru', intransitive verb
seclusion from the world; retirement from society
General term for withdrawing from worldly affairs to live in quiet isolation. Often used in literary or historical contexts.
彼は都会を離れ、山奥で遁世した。
He left the city and secluded himself deep in the mountains.
遁世生活に憧れる
Some people long for a life of seclusion from the world.
noun, noun or participle which takes 'suru', intransitive verb
monastic seclusion; religious retreat
Specifically refers to leaving secular life to become a monk or nun, often in a Buddhist context.
彼は仏門に入り、遁世の道を選んだ。
He entered the Buddhist priesthood and chose the path of monastic seclusion.
